|
Stock-Based Compensation (Details 3) (Stock options, USD $)
In Millions, except Share data, unless otherwise specified
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Share-based Compensation
|
|
|
|Number of options (in shares)
|3,401,395us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
|
|
|Options Exercisable (in shares)
|1,097,747us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
|
|
|Total estimated grant date fair value of options vested
|$ 0.8us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sVestedInPeriodFairValue1
|$ 0.1us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sVestedInPeriodFairValue1
|$ 0.2us-gaap_SharebasedCompensationArrangementBySharebasedPaymentAwardOptionsVestedInPeriodFairValue1
|$0.0058
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 0.0058us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eOneMember
|
|
|Number of options (in shares)
|25,169us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eOneMember
|
|
|Weighted-Average Remaining Contractual Life
|5 years 10 months 24 days
|
|
|Options Exercisable (in shares)
|25,169us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eOneMember
|
|
|$0.986
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 0.986us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eTwoMember
|
|
|Number of options (in shares)
|874,979us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eTwoMember
|
|
|Weighted-Average Remaining Contractual Life
|6 years 9 months 18 days
|
|
|Options Exercisable (in shares)
|698,392us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eTwoMember
|
|
|$1.218
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 1.218us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eThreeMember
|
|
|Number of options (in shares)
|508,060us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eThreeMember
|
|
|Weighted-Average Remaining Contractual Life
|8 years
|
|
|Options Exercisable (in shares)
|243,441us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eThreeMember
|
|
|$1.74
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 1.74us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FourMember
|
|
|Number of options (in shares)
|332,621us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FourMember
|
|
|Weighted-Average Remaining Contractual Life
|8 years 7 months 6 days
|
|
|Options Exercisable (in shares)
|117,313us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FourMember
|
|
|$5.51
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 5.51us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FiveMember
|
|
|Number of options (in shares)
|504,646us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FiveMember
|
|
|Weighted-Average Remaining Contractual Life
|9 years 4 months 24 days
|
|
|Options Exercisable (in shares)
|7,614us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eFiveMember
|
|
|$15.78
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 15.78us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eSixMember
|
|
|Number of options (in shares)
|29,085us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eSixMember
|
|
|Weighted-Average Remaining Contractual Life
|9 years 10 months 24 days
|
|
|$16.00
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 16.00us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eSevenMember
|
|
|Number of options (in shares)
|1,084,835us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eSevenMember
|
|
|Weighted-Average Remaining Contractual Life
|9 years 9 months 18 days
|
|
|Options Exercisable (in shares)
|5,818us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fExercisableO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eSevenMember
|
|
|$17.84
|
|
|
|Share-based Compensation
|
|
|
|Exercise Price (in dollars per share)
|$ 17.84us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eEightMember
|
|
|Number of options (in shares)
|42,000us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_AwardTypeAxis
= derm_EmployeeAndNonEmployeeStockOptionMember
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= derm_ExercisePriceRangeEightMember
|
|
|Weighted-Average Remaining Contractual Life
|9 years 10 months 24 days
|
|